I recently had dinner at the Virginia Inn and it was a wonderful experience from start to finish!
Kids Burger: The kids burger was a hit with my little one. It was perfectly sized, juicy, and came with a side of crispy fries that were devoured in minutes. The presentation was appealing, and it was clear they put thought into making it kid-friendly and tasty.
Soup du Jour: The soup du jour was a pleasant surprise. It was a hearty and flavorful concoction that felt like a warm hug in a bowl. The ingredients were fresh, and the seasoning was spot on, making it a perfect start to the meal.
Calamari: The calamari was cooked to perfection--crispy on the outside and tender inside. The accompanying dipping sauce added a nice kick, making each bite delightful. It was a generous portion, great for sharing.
Shrimp and Grits: The shrimp and grits were the star of the show. The shrimp were plump and perfectly cooked, and the grits were creamy with just the right amount of cheese. The dish was well-seasoned, and the flavors blended beautifully, making it a comforting and satisfying choice.
Overall, the Virginia Inn delivered a delicious and memorable dining experience. The food was top-notch, the service was friendly, and the atmosphere was cozy. Highly recommend for a family dinner or a night out!
